The pair were training
with the Egyptian national squad preparing for
the Pharaohs crucial upcoming World Cup qualifier
against the D.R Congo.
Mido limped out of the training
session but luckily for him, the injury is minimal,
and he is expected to be fit in time for the
Congo D.R match.
Speaking to Egyptianplayers.com,
Mido said, “I want to take part in the
match, even if I will play for a few minutes.
“I will do whatever it takes
to be fit for the game. I may start on the bench.”
Mido moved to Boro last summer
for a fee of £6m from Tottenham. He has
however, been hampered by injury, meaning that
he was only able to make 14 league appearances
for the club, scoring three times in the process.
Unfortunately for Boro boss Gareth
Southgate, Shawky’s injury is a little
more serious, and will see him miss at least
two to three weeks of Boro’s Premier League
campaign.
As a result, Shawky will not travel
to Congo D.R, and will instead either remain
in Egypt or fly back to England for treatment
on the groin strain.
Shawky was signed by Southgate
on the last day of the transfer window last
season, for a fee of £650,000. After having
a slow start to his Boro career blighted by
injuries, Shawky is now looking to secure a
first team place in the side, and will hope
to build on the five league appearances he made
for the club last season
